FL S0428
Bill
AI Summary
-
Requires annual reporting by schools on student participation in fine arts courses (visual arts, music, dance, and theatre), educator certification status, and compliance with fine arts standards in the Next Generation Sunshine State Standards.
-
Mandates inclusion of fine arts course participation rates in school grades beginning with the 2013-2014 school year for schools with any grades kindergarten through 12.
-
Updates terminology in school grading provisions to clarify language regarding students designated as "hospital/homebound" rather than "hospital-designated" or "hospital- or homebound."
-
Modifies language regarding alternative school data inclusion in home school grades, changing from "shall not" to "may not" be included in home school calculations if the alternative school chooses to be graded separately.
-
Takes effect July 1, 2013.
Legislative Description
Public School Student Participation in Fine Arts Courses
Last Action
Died in Education
5/3/2013
